WHERE WE TREAT

Five areas of focus.

Pests follow a route onto a property before they ever get inside it. We treat that route, not just the rooms where you'd notice them.

1

Perimeter

Before pests reach the yard or the house, they cross the perimeter. Treating that line first is what keeps the rest of the property clear.

2

Eaves

Wasps and hornets nest here more than almost anywhere else on a property. We inspect the eaves for nests and the gaps that let them start one.

3

Foundation

Cracks and gaps in the foundation are how crawling pests get inside. Exterior treatment here forms the barrier that keeps them out.

4

Pathways

The routes pests actually travel to reach the house. Interrupting them here stops problems before they reach the door.

5

Interior

Food, water, and shelter make the inside of a home the last stop. We treat where pests are most likely to settle in.
